THIS COMMUNITY HAS BEEN BANNED: Visualizing Reddit's Banning Practices
Current as of 2020
Subreddit bans have received a considerable amount of attention in recent years. The goal of this visualization was to create a timeline that visualizes banning practices from the well-known r/TheFappening to r/DeepFakes. Along with dates when subreddits are banned, I included some major events as well as dates of when media pieces are published that may have put increased pressure on the website to change policies and enact bans. Reddit, like any other system, faces pressure from outside sources and may act accordingly, thus illustrating the crossovers of outlets in the media economy.
